WebMar 21, 2024 · However, while owning the home, the owner spent $75,000 on capital improvements, including a new roof, a swimming pool and a kitchen remodel. Adding $75,000 in capital improvements to the $200,000 purchase price brings the cost basis to $275,000. Now the gain on the sale is $500,000 minus $275,000 or $225,000. WebFor example, you can install entrance ramps, create modified bathrooms, lower cabinets, widen doors, add handrails, and create special doors. These are all improvements that can be deducted through the medical expense deduction. The deductions must be considered reasonable and must have a practical use. HOME Program funds may only be used to assist households with incomes at or below 80 percent of area median income.
